Serving 566 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Glen Park Academy For Excel In Learning 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Indiana for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 4% (which is lower than the Indiana state average of 39%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 9% (which is lower than the Indiana state average of 41%).
The student-teacher ratio of 15:1 is equal to the Indiana state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 99%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Indiana state average of 38% (majority Hispanic and Black).

School Overview

Glen Park Academy For Excel In Learning's student population of 566 students has grown by 9% over five school years.
The teacher population of 37 teachers has grown by 19% over five school years.
